Coming to you from Doc's Crocks is this wonderful Decorated Stoneware 8 3/4" Jar.
The form and decoration indicate that it was made by Henry Remmey, Jr. of Philadelphia who ran the family pottery in Philadelphia from the 1820's to the 1850's (Phil Shaltenbrand, Big Ware Turners, pp. 8-10).
Circa 1840, this beauty features a Squared Rim, Grooved Shoulder, Warm Gray Glaze, and Brushed Cobalt Floral Decoration. The florals consist of two tulips with leaves and blossom, and one leaf. Stands 8 3/4" tall.
Excellent Condition. A tiny 1/8" nibble and surface ping line at the rim (closeup). That's it! No inner rim or base chips, hairlines, cracks, stains, or restoration.
